Green steel startup Boston Metal is doubling down on critical metals
BOSTON METAL IS DOUBLING DOWN ON CRITICAL METALS WITH NEW FUNDING
Boston Metal, a startup initially recognized for its innovative approaches to clean steel production, is now making a significant pivot towards critical metals. The company has successfully raised $75 million in funding, which will enable it to expand its focus beyond steel to include essential metals like niobium, tantalum, and nickel. This strategic shift comes at a crucial time when the demand for sustainable industrial practices is becoming increasingly important, yet support for industrial decarbonization in the U.S. has been waning. With this new funding, Boston Metal aims to solidify its position in the critical metals market while continuing its commitment to reducing greenhouse gas emissions.
HOW BOSTON METAL IS EXPANDING BEYOND STEEL PRODUCTION
While Boston Metal has primarily been associated with steel production, its recent funding will allow the company to leverage its existing technology for a broader range of metals. The startup has established a subsidiary, Boston Metal do Brasil, which is setting up a commercial facility in Brazil dedicated to producing critical metals. This facility will not only focus on niobium and tantalum but will also explore opportunities in producing tin. By diversifying its production capabilities, Boston Metal is positioning itself to meet the growing global demand for critical metals, which are essential for various high-tech applications, including electronics and renewable energy technologies.
THE SIGNIFICANCE OF BOSTON METAL'S $75 MILLION FUNDING ROUND
The recent $75 million funding round is a pivotal moment for Boston Metal, as it not only provides the necessary capital to support its new initiatives but also signifies investor confidence in the company's vision for the future. This funding is particularly crucial following cash-flow challenges the company faced earlier this year, which were exacerbated by an industrial accident at its Brazilian facility. The financial backing will help stabilize operations and facilitate the development of new technologies and processes for extracting critical metals. BOSTON METAL'S STRATEGY FOR SURVIVING INDUSTRIAL DECARBONIZATION CHALLENGES
To navigate the challenges posed by industrial decarbonization, Boston Metal is implementing a multi-faceted strategy that includes technological innovation and market diversification. The company's core technology, molten oxide electrolysis (MOE), allows for efficient extraction of metals from ores while minimizing environmental impact. By focusing on critical metals, Boston Metal aims to tap into new markets that are increasingly prioritizing sustainability. Additionally, the establishment of its Brazilian facility will enable the company to scale its operations and enhance its production capabilities.
